MPL Malaysia S15 Returns With A New Smartphone Sponsor

Mobile Legends: Bang Bang Professional League (MPL) Malaysia is back for Season 15, and this time, it’s bringing a new power-up—Infinix. The smartphone brand has signed on as the Official Gaming Smartphone Partner, making its GT 20 Pro the go-to device for Malaysia’s biggest and longest-running esports league.
This partnership isn’t just a one-season fling—it’s part of a multi-year regional deal, covering pro Mobile Legends tournaments across five Southeast Asian countries. Infinix aims to push the limits of mobile gaming, ensuring that both players and fans get a top-tier experience. Or, in simpler terms, they want to sell you a gaming phone while making sure esports in Malaysia stays competitive, accessible, and—most importantly—entertaining.
The collaboration was officially unveiled at the Infinix Iftar Night 2025: Powering the Future with MPL Malaysia, held at Royal Bedouin in Sri Hartamas. And if you’re wondering, yes, I was there, and yes, the food was amazing.
For this season, the battlefield shifts to Stadium Juara, the so-called “Stadium of Champions”—a fitting stage after Malaysia’s rollercoaster 2024. The country saw its best international Mobile Legends performance yet, clinching victories at the Mid Season Cup (MSC) and the World Esports Championship (WEC), as well as crowning its first-ever back-to-back MPL Malaysia champion. But the fairy tale ended in heartbreak when Malaysia fell short of winning the M6 World Championship on home soil.
With that bitter taste still fresh, Season 15 launches with a bold new identity—“Pentas Kebanggaan” (The Stage of Pride). It’s not just about pro players anymore; the league wants everyone—players, coaches, casters, content creators, and fans—to feel like they’re part of something bigger.
This season welcomes some major shake-ups:
Selangor Red Giants have gone full international, partnering with the legendary European esports org OG Esports. They’ll now compete under the banner Selangor Red Giants OG Esports (SRG)—a first-of-its-kind collab for MPL Malaysia.
Red Esports has rebranded as Aero, because, well… new name, new start.
Two fresh teams, Ocean Black and DX Soul, have fought their way up from the MLBB Academy League Malaysia (MALMY) and are ready to shake things up.
The league sticks with its tried-and-tested two-phase format:
Regular Season (19 April – 25 May)
10 teams, single round-robin, Best-Of-Three (BO3) matches.
The season opener? A fiery Grand Finals rematch between SRG and Team Vamos—both eager to prove themselves after their M6 heartbreak.
Playoffs (30-31 May & 14-15 June)
Unlike past seasons, where weekday matches led to fans missing out due to work and school, this time, the Playoffs will be split across two weekends for a better experience.
And for the first time ever, MPL Malaysia is launching official league merchandise—because what’s an esports league without some branded drip?
Season 15 is shaping up to be more than just another tournament; it’s a statement. With new sponsors (Infinix, Head & Shoulders, and Fairrie), new teams, and a fresh brand direction, MPL Malaysia is doubling down on its mission to elevate local esports.
Now, all that’s left is to see if Malaysia can turn last year’s heartbreak into triumph. Until then, we’ll just have to enjoy the ride.
